Re: Deprecating eCos 2.0


Gary Thomas wrote:
Can we make the automated download tool (ecos-install.tcl) use
a CVS snapshot instead of the old 2.0?  It would solve so many
"I'm using 2.0 ..." issues if this was the default.

Note: I don't care if it still downloads the old tools (which
are also labeled 2.0) as for the most part, they don't get
in the way.

It's certainly possible. Not a great message in one sense, but it would do the job for now. Despite not much in the way of QA, it's arguably less relevant to commend 2.0.


But if we did, it would still want a version number distinct from true CVS, i.e. instead of "current" for packages. Perhaps something like 2.1a-cvs or 2.1a-interim? We'd also need a doc rebuild to make sense. Similarly what about the prebuilt configtool and ecosconfig? The only prebuilt versions that work with cygwin are on ecoscentric's site.

So even a quicky respin isn't quite trivial but it wouldn't take long. Not something to announce with a fanfare though.
